I'd start by disassembling both halves and seeing what's still intact. Obviously anything running through the hinge has to be replaced (two ribbon cables and a wire as far as I can tell). I can't tell what they connect to, but they should be easy enough to find once you figure that out. If you need help ID'ing anything, post a pic or two, we'll be here
